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Butlers Lane to St James Park (Exeter) start from as little as £48.70

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Butlers Lane to St James Park (Exeter) start from £118.60 one way, or £120.00 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Butlers Lane to St James Park (Exeter) are available for £122.10 one way, or £244.00 return

Facilities at Butlers Lane

Butlers Lane is a modest station that ensures essential services are available for travelers. While it does have ticket machines for purchasing or collecting online tickets, it lacks some modern amenities like accessible ticket machines and smartcard validation. Fortunately, there are staff members present during specific hours, notably on Fridays and weekends, to assist with journey planning and passenger needs. The station even prides itself on its Secure Station accreditation, ensuring safety and peace of mind for all passengers.

Amenities and Accessibility

While the station doesn’t boast conveniences like refreshment facilities or accessible toilets, it offers basic seating and a waiting area. Travelers intending to cycle have a few bike stands at their disposal. In terms of accessibility, Butlers Lane is classified as a Category C station, indicating that step-free access is not available throughout. Travelers in need of assistance should make themselves known to conductors in advance for easier boarding.

Seamless Travel Connections

Although facilities such as car parking, shops, or ATMs are unavailable, Butlers Lane does offer robust connections to surrounding areas through different modes of transport. Rail replacement services are conveniently located on Lichfield Road, and taxis can be easily snagged with a quick call — Sutton Radio and Parkers are just a couple of options available. For those looking to continue their journey via bus, details are readily accessible online in printable formats for ease of planning.

Facilities at St James Park (Exeter)

St James Park is a minimalist station with straightforward amenities. While it doesn't boast a ticket office or ticket machines, travelers can still prepare ahead by purchasing tickets online. For those with accessibility needs, it's important to note that while there's some step-free access, reaching the Exeter-bound platform involves a degree of difficulty with no fully accessible route available. However, the Exmouth-bound platform can be accessed via a steep ramp.

Despite the absence of wait rooms, refreshment facilities, and an ATM, you'll find a seating area to rest your feet. There's also an induction loop within the station to assist those with hearing impairments. Although staff-driven assistance is not available, a help point ensures that information and support needs are met.

Travel Connections and Onward Journeys

Transport links from St James Park offer opportunities to explore Exeter and beyond. While direct taxi services aren't available at the station, the nearby Old Tiverton Road provides convenient bus stops for onward travel. For cycling enthusiasts, although no bicycle hire is directly available, the station offers four parking spaces for bicycles.
